Comprehending the Importance of Professional Credentials
The area of art assessment is not regulated by the state similarly as real estate or medicine. This suggests anybody can technically call themselves an evaluator, making it essential for collection agencies to do their due persistance. When you begin your search in Oakland, seek professionals that belong to recognized national organizations. These teams require their members to undergo substantial training and follow a rigorous code of values. A competent evaluator will typically hold a qualification that confirms they have actually passed strenuous tests and preserve their education and learning with routine updates.
One of the most critical standards to look for is conformity with the Uniform Standards of Professional Appraisal Practice. These standards make sure that the assessment process is handled with impartiality and neutrality. In 2026, lots of regional professionals are also concentrating on brand-new academic requirements pertaining to assessment bias and reasonable real estate regulations, showing a broader dedication to equity within the market. By choosing a person with these credentials, you make certain that your assessment report will certainly withstand the analysis of insurance provider, tax obligation authorities, and legal professionals.

Transparency and Ethical Fee Structures
A respectable evaluator will constantly be transparent concerning their prices and the scope of their job. You ought to stay clear of any type of professional that uses to bill a percent of the assessed value. This method develops a clear conflict of rate of interest, as it incentivizes the appraiser to inflate the value to boost their own cost. Instead, most certified professionals in the Bay Area charge a per hour price or a flat cost per job. They need to provide you with a written contract that details precisely what services they will certainly execute and what the final report will certainly include.
Ethical requirements likewise determine that an appraiser must not offer to purchase the items they are reviewing. Their function is to give an unbiased point of view of value, not to work as a supplier seeking a bargain. This splitting up of functions is basic to preserving trust fund. If you are considering marketing your things with a design auction in the future, your appraiser must be able to assist you on the best places for your specific pieces without having a monetary stake in the result. This objective suggestions is what you are paying for when you hire a specialist.
Preparing for the Appraisal Process
Once you have selected an appraiser, you can assist the process step smoothly by gathering any type of paperwork you have for your collection. This consists of initial acquisition invoices, gallery billings, certifications of credibility, and any kind of documents of previous restorations. If an item has a notable background, such as being showed in a museum or had by a famous figure, this details-- referred to as provenance-- can significantly enhance its worth. Having these details all set allows the appraiser to focus their time on research study and analysis rather than management jobs.
Throughout the site go to, guarantee that the art work is quickly accessible and well-lit. The appraiser will likely take thorough photos and measurements of each thing. They may additionally use specialized devices like ultraviolet lights to check for surprise repairs or changes. Don't be afraid to ask questions during this go to. An excellent professional will enjoy to explain their method and the factors they are taking into consideration. This interaction assists you understand real nature of your collection and gives comfort that your properties are being handled with care.
Finalizing the Valuation Report
Completion result of your collaboration will certainly be an official assessment record. This record should be detailed and well-organized, featuring a clear description of each item, its problem, and the thinking behind the designated worth. In 2026, these reports are progressively digital, enabling high-resolution images and easy sharing with insurance agents or lawful counsel. Guarantee that the record explicitly mentions the "designated usage," whether it is for insurance coverage replacement value, inheritance tax functions, or possible liquidation.
A high-quality record serves as a long-term record of your collection's worth at a specific time. Because the art market is frequently shifting, it is normally recommended to have your collection re-evaluated every three to 5 years. This ensures that your insurance policy protection remains sufficient which your estate preparation reflects present market truths.
